What is Freight?

Freight refers to products, goods, or merchandise that are transported in a ship, train, airplane, truck, or van. In other words, we can carry freight by air, sea, or land.

Historically, freight has referred to transportation by land, unlike cargo which is for sea or air transportation. Once freight arrives on land, it is transported to its destination by drayage carriers. That is why the terms freight train or freight truck are much more common than cargo trucks or trains. Ships and planes have generally been called cargo planes or cargo ships. However, there is a lot of overlap today and you might see and hear the two terms – cargo and freight – used interchangeably in virtually all situations.

What is a Freight Broker?

A freight broker plays a crucial role in assisting shippers who require transportation for their freight. Their primary task involves connecting the freight with qualified and capable carriers, ensuring its safe delivery to the intended destination. Should I Hire a Freight Broker Company?

A freight broker business facilitates an agreement between parties involved and ensures efficient communication and execution of freight hand-offs. They act as the intermediary between manufacturers and transportation providers, guaranteeing the successful delivery of products to their final destinations.

Freight carriers are constantly seeking to optimize their truck and vehicle capacity by minimizing empty space. This can be challenging for carriers as they make multiple stops along their routes, leaving behind shipments at each location. Their objective is to maximize the amount of freight they can transport, ensuring minimal unused space.
